About this race
The Final Countdown - Tribute
Date: September 19, 2026
Location: Amani Brewing, Martinsburg, WV
Registration Link: Register Here
Event Overview
- Origin: A huge shoutout to Jeff and Jeremy from The Ultra Running Guys. They organized 'The Final Countdown' in NC for 4 years.
- Concept: This fun and challenging race is being brought to WV with permission to "steal" the idea!
- Inclusivity: You are invited to this unique race experience that caters to everyone from new runners to experienced ultra runners.
- Challenge: As the race progresses, you must hold off your own "Final Countdown" as long as possible.
Course Details
- Loop Length: The course is a 1.33 mile loop located on the property of Amani Brewery.
- Trail Condition: The grass path is taken care of and mowed all year round, providing a smooth, fast trail.
- Lap Timing: Every lap, all runners leave together and must complete the loop in the allotted time.
- Breaks: If you finish the loop before the Countdown completes, you can take a break, grab a drink, or check social media.
Countdown Mechanics
- Lap Speed: Each lap will get slightly faster than the last, starting with the first lap at 20 minutes (15:02/mile pace).
- Time Reduction: For each successive lap, the countdown will be 20 seconds shorter, pushing you to go faster.
- Race Conclusion: If you don't return before the Countdown reaches "0", your adventure is over.
- Final Competitor: The race ends when only one runner returns before the completion of "The Final Countdown".
